I have spent a long time trying to work with my Hi-Val DD0203, which is a rebatched Optorite manufactured by Sanyo. The drive came with firmware release 2.23 and initially it couldn't do anything other than reading DVD-ROMs. It couldn't even read the CD software that came with the drive. Since then I found out a few things about the drive. 1) If you run into problems, flash the drive. Sometimes flashing it just once won't do anything. The first time I tried flashing it with 2.30 and that didn't do a single thing. Flash it until it works! 2) It has to work in a cool environment. It was giving me problems when I had it stacked up between other 5.25" drives. As soon I placed it at the top of the stack, it started burning like a champ. So make sure you have good circulation in your PC case. 3) My computer froze in the middle of the flash procedure and I was forced to reset it. This messed up the flash image in the burner and I could not see the drive again either at bootup (BIOS) or in Windows. I thought the drive was dead. Then I fiddled with the jumpers in the back of the drive and I put the jumper to the second position from the right. It worked again! So once Windows booted up I flashed the drive again with 2.30 and moved the jumper back to the original position (far right) and the PC had no problem seeing the drive. I think this is not a simple drive to work with initially. But once you learned all the tricks about the drive you will have no problem burning anything you want. Now I am a happy camper! Column Explanation: ![]() New comments= New comments since your last visit. New Writer = New DVD Writer since your last vist. OEM Original Equipment Manufacturer. Chipset The manufacturer of the main chipset the DVD writer/recorder is based on. Write support / Read support DVD-R = Works DVD-R? = Not tested Single Layer(4.7GB) write speeds 1x (CLV) = about 58 minutes 2x (CLV) = about 29 minutes 2.4x (CLV) = about 24 minutes 4x (CLV) = about 14.5 minutes 6x (CLV/ZCLV) = about 10-12 minutes 8x (PCAV/ZCLV) = about 8-10 minutes 12x (PCAV/ZCLV) = about 6.5-7.5 minutes 16x (CAV/ZCLV) = about 6-7 minutes Dual/Double Layer(8.5GB) write speeds 1x CLV = about 105 minutes 2.4x CLV = about 44 minutes 4x CLV = about 27 minutes Single Layer (4.7GB) read speeds 1x read speed is 1.321MB/s = ~56 minutes 6x CAV (avg. ~4x) read speed is max 7.93MB/s = ~14 minutes 8x CAV (avg. ~6x) read speed is max 10.57MB/s = ~10 minutes 12x CAV (avg. ~8x) read speed is max 15.85MB/s = ~7 minutes 16x CAV (avg. ~12x) read speed is max 21.13MB/s = ~5 minutes DVD Write types CAV = Constant Angular Velocity, the DVD is written at a constantly increasing speed. CLV = Constant Linear Velocity, the DVD is written at a constant speed. ZCLV = Zone Constant Linear Velocity, the DVD is divided into zones. After each zone the write speed is increased. PCAV = Partial Constant Angular Velocity, the DVD is being written at an increasing speed until a certain speed. After this speed it will not increase anymore.
